Jerónimo Martins stock (PTJMT0AE0001): Portuguese retailer pays dividend as earnings stabilize

13.05.2026 - 12:55:46 | ad-hoc-news.de

Jerónimo Martins announced a €0.65 dividend per share on May 12, 2026, marking continued shareholder returns from the Portuguese food retail and distribution group.

Jeronimo Martins, PTJMT0AE0001
Jeronimo Martins, PTJMT0AE0001

Jerónimo Martins, one of Portugal's largest retail and distribution companies, declared a dividend of €0.65 per share with an ex-dividend date of May 8, 2026, according to DivvyDiary as of May 12, 2026. The payment represents a 3.60% yield and underscores the company's commitment to returning capital to shareholders despite a challenging retail environment.

Jerónimo Martins: core business model

Jerónimo Martins operates as a vertically integrated food retail and distribution company with operations spanning Portugal, Poland, and Brazil. The group's primary revenue streams include the Pingo Doce supermarket chain in Portugal, the Recheio wholesale business serving independent retailers, and Biedronka, a discount supermarket chain in Poland. This diversified model allows the company to serve both retail consumers and independent store operators, creating multiple touchpoints across the food distribution value chain.

The company's Portuguese operations remain its historical core, but international expansion—particularly in Poland through Biedronka—has become increasingly important to overall profitability and growth. The wholesale segment (Recheio) provides stable, recurring revenue from independent retailers who depend on centralized distribution to compete with larger supermarket chains.

Main revenue and product drivers for Jerónimo Martins

Food products and groceries represent the largest revenue category, accounting for the majority of sales across all operating segments. The company also generates revenue from private-label products, pharmaceuticals, and non-food items such as household goods and personal care products. Biedronka's discount positioning in Poland has proven resilient during economic uncertainty, while Pingo Doce maintains a strong market position in Portugal through a combination of convenience and competitive pricing.

The dividend announcement reflects management confidence in cash generation despite inflationary pressures on consumer spending and supply chain costs. Retailers across Europe have faced margin compression, but Jerónimo Martins' scale and operational efficiency have enabled it to maintain shareholder distributions while investing in store modernization and digital capabilities.
